Susquehanna Fundamental Investments LLC Makes New Investment in Open Text Co. (NASDAQ:OTEX)

Open Text logo with Computer and Technology background

Susquehanna Fundamental Investments LLC purchased a new stake in Open Text Co. (NASDAQ:OTEX - Free Report) TSE: OTC during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or purchased 143,500 shares of the software maker's stock, valued at approximately $4,064,000. Susquehanna Fundamental Investments LLC owned approximately 0.05% of Open Text as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Open Text Stock Up 1.2 %

NASDAQ:OTEX traded up $0.31 during mid-day trading on Friday, reaching $26.16. The stock had a trading volume of 1,873,314 shares, compared to its average volume of 822,534.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.50, a current ratio of 0.87 and a quick ratio of 0.87. The stock has a market cap of $6.79 billion, a P/E ratio of 10.63 and a beta of 1.13. The business's 50 day moving average is $25.72 and its 200 day moving average is $28.11. Open Text Co. has a fifty-two week low of $22.79 and a fifty-two week high of $34.20.

Open Text (NASDAQ:OTEX - Get Free Report) TSE: OTC last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, April 30th. The software maker reported $0.82 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.81 by $0.01. The company had revenue of $1.25 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.28 billion. Open Text had a net margin of 12.21% and a return on equity of 23.23%. Open Text's quarterly revenue was down 13.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$0.94 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ts predict that Open Text Co. will post 3.45 earnings per share for the current year.

Open Text Dividend Announcement

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, June 20th. Stockholders of record on Friday, June 6th will be paid a dividend of $0.2625 per share. The ex-dividend date is Friday, June 6th. This represents a $1.05 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 4.01%. Open Text's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 42.68%.

About Open Text

(Free Report)

Open Text Corporation provides information management software and solutions. The company offers content services, which includes content collaboration and intelligent capture to records management, collaboration, e-signatures, and archiving; and operates experience cloud platform that provides customer experience and web content management, digital asset management, customer analytics, AI and insights, e-discovery, digital fax, omnichannel communications, secure messaging, and voice of customer, as well as customer journey, testing, and segmentation.
